The ideal amount of water in a toilet tank is about one to two inches below the fill valve and overflow tube, or the large open pipe in the middle of the tank. If the float is set low, the tank will fill to a lower height. Ideally the water level inside a toilet tank should be about 1/2 inch below the overflow tube.

Ideally, the water level in your toilet tank should sit one to two inches below the toilet’s fill valve and/or overflow tube. If the level of water is an inch below the opening of the overflow tube, the toilet tank may not be the problem.
